Viñas Viejas

2008 Calatayud Garnacha

Las Rocas Viñas Viejas, a captivating Garnacha from the renowned Calatayud region, boasts a rich red hue that invites exploration. This 2008 vintage reveals a full-bodied character that harmoniously balances its moderate acidity, providing a pleasing mouthfeel that enhances its overall appeal. The wine exhibits prominent fruit intensity, showcasing luscious notes of ripe red berries and cherries that tantalize the senses. The tannins are notable yet well-integrated, adding structure without overwhelming the palate. Offering a dry profile, this Garnacha is perfect for pairing with hearty dishes, making it a delightful choice for any occasion. Enjoy the complexity and depth that Las Rocas Viñas Viejas has to offer, as it highlights the exceptional winemaking traditions of its region.

Region:


Spain
Spain

While its reputation as a serious wine destination was eclipsed by France and Italy for many years, ignoring Spain today means missing out on some of the world's most exciting wines. Enjoying hundreds of miles of sun-kissed coastline and rocky interiors at higher elevations, Spain provides an ideal location for vineyards. Whether it is sparkling cavas from Catalonia, crisp Verdejos from Rueda, sublime Tempranillos from Ribera del Duero or inky Monastrells from Valencia, Spain has many wine styles to explore, all expressing the country's wildly unique terroir.
